The most significant danger is that these images can be bundled with malware, rootkits, or keyloggers. Since the builder has complete control over the files included, a malicious actor could embed trojans that activate after the system is installed, compromising your data or turning your computer into a botnet node. Even if an ISO is advertised as "clean" on a forum, there is rarely any way to verify its integrity without building it yourself from a trusted source.

Seek out verifiable, "untouched" MSDN or retail ISO images of Windows Vista. Digital archiving platforms like the Internet Archive often host original, unmodified installation media uploaded by preservationists. Always verify the SHA-1 or MD5 hash values of the downloaded ISO against official Microsoft documentation to ensure the file has not been altered. Run Vista inside a Virtual Machine

Searching for a "Windows Vista pre-activated ISO new" opens the door to severe security vulnerabilities, system instability, and malicious software. Windows Vista is an obsolete platform that cannot be secured for modern internet use. If your project requires this specific operating system, protect yourself by sourcing an original, unmodified ISO file, running it strictly inside an isolated virtual machine, and avoiding the dangerous shortcuts promised by pre-activated downloads.
